将我的.vimrc文件复制到windows后,我注意到有很多问题。我修复了大部分内容,但是我注意到任何带有<CR>
命令的内容都不起作用。我只是听到“叮”声。
以下是一个命令的示例,该命令不会导致错误,但不会执行预期的操作。我只是听到了叮当声
let mapleader = ","
let g:mapleader = ","
nmap <leader>w :w!<cr>
我是否应该使用某种东西而不是<CR>
?请注意,我确实 google it
答案 0 :(得分:2)
我认为您的配置没有任何问题(好吧,您可能不需要重复的mapleader
定义)。在命令行模式下映射<CR>
时,我只能想象出问题。因此,you should use :noremap
;它使映射不受重映射和递归的影响。要检查mapleader的问题,请尝试通过原始领导者调用,即 \ W 。此外,您可以通过:verbose nmap <Leader>w
检查您的映射(不会被覆盖/清除)。